commit 3be97ff62cfca99c25dd1c497cb49ee0eaac7eef
Author: Alexander V. Chernikov <melifaro@FreeBSD.org>
Date:   Mon Feb 8 22:30:39 2021 +0000

    Revert "SO_RERROR indicates that receive buffer overflows"
    
    Wrong version of the change was pushed inadvertenly.
    
    This reverts commit 4a01b854ca5c2e5124958363b3326708b913af71.

Diff:
---
 newlib/libc/sys/rtems/include/sys/socket.h | 1 -
 1 file changed, 1 deletion(-)

diff --git a/newlib/libc/sys/rtems/include/sys/socket.h b/newlib/libc/sys/rtems/include/sys/socket.h
index 54cd0be93..4079b3e91 100644
--- a/newlib/libc/sys/rtems/include/sys/socket.h
+++ b/newlib/libc/sys/rtems/include/sys/socket.h
@@ -139,7 +139,6 @@ typedef	__uintptr_t	uintptr_t;
 #define	SO_NO_OFFLOAD	0x00004000	/* socket cannot be offloaded */
 #define	SO_NO_DDP	0x00008000	/* disable direct data placement */
 #define	SO_REUSEPORT_LB	0x00010000	/* reuse with load balancing */
-#define	SO_RERROR	0x00020000	/* keep track of receive errors */
 
 /*
  * Additional options, not kept in so_options.
